Choosing your conservatory

Once you have decided to add a conservatory to your home there are some important points to consider

Is there enough space surrounding your property in which to fit a conservatory, allowing for easy access to all areas?

Would a conservatory look appropriate as part of your house? If so, what style and shape would be best? Request a 3D design from your local JWS Installer to see how an Jones Window Systems conservatory would look on your home. 

The type of home you have - for instance if you live in a bungalow your installer will need to include a box-gutter in the design of your conservatory (as shown on the picture, top right)
